Earth-90214 is the noir-influenced reality of Spider-Man Noir, a dark alternate universe set primarily in New York City during the Great Depression. Unlike Earth-616, this reality is shaped less by bright superhuman spectacle and more by organized crime, political corruption, economic desperation, social unrest, and morally complicated vigilante justice.

In this reality, Peter Parker was raised by his Aunt May and Uncle Ben Parker, both of whom were socially conscious reformers who opposed the corruption and exploitation consuming New York City. Uncle Ben’s murder by forces connected to Norman Osborn, the crime lord known as the Goblin, became one of the defining tragedies of Peter’s life.
Peter’s path changed after he came under the influence of Daily Bugle photographer Ben Urich, whose knowledge of the city’s criminal world helped expose Peter to the extent of Osborn’s power. While investigating stolen artifacts connected to the Goblin’s operations, Peter encountered a spider idol containing mystical spiders. After being bitten, he gained spider-like powers and became the vigilante known as Spider-Man.
Spider-Man Noir adopted a dark costume inspired in part by his Uncle Ben’s World War I-era airman gear. Operating from the shadows, he fought Osborn’s criminal empire and its enforcers, including noir versions of familiar villains such as Vulture, Kraven, Chameleon, and others. His early methods were harsher than those of many Spider-Men, reflecting the brutality of the world around him.
The conflict against the Goblin’s empire defined Earth-90214’s earliest known history. Peter fought not only individual criminals, but a system in which wealth, organized crime, political influence, and law enforcement corruption were deeply entangled. Figures such as Felicia Hardy, owner of the Black Cat club, and J. Jonah Jameson also played significant roles in the city’s struggle for truth and survival.
Earth-90214 later became significant beyond its own reality during multiversal Spider-events. Spider-Man Noir joined other Spider-powered heroes during the Spider-Verse conflict against the Inheritors, predators who hunted spider-totems across realities. He later became associated with the Web-Warriors, expanding Earth-90214’s importance within the larger Web of Life and Destiny.
During later multiversal conflicts, Spider-Man Noir was killed by Morlun, but he was eventually restored through mystical spider-totem forces. This resurrection reinforced the supernatural foundation of his powers and distinguished Earth-90214 from more science-driven Spider-Man realities.
Earth-90214 remains one of the most distinctive Spider-realities: a world of rain-soaked streets, corrupt systems, private clubs, desperate workers, violent criminals, and one masked vigilante determined to protect the powerless from those who believe power gives them the right to prey on others.

The inhabitants of Earth-90214 are largely ordinary humans living under the pressures of the Great Depression. Superhuman activity is rare and often carries mystical, experimental, or pulp-crime overtones rather than the widespread superhero culture seen on Earth-616. Criminal syndicates, corrupt industrialists, compromised officials, desperate workers, journalists, reformers, and vigilantes define much of this reality’s social landscape.
Spider-Man Noir is the reality’s most prominent superhuman defender. His powers include enhanced strength, agility, reflexes, wall-crawling, spider-sense, and the ability to generate organic webbing from his wrists. His existence introduces a mystical spider-totem element into an otherwise grounded noir crime setting.
